Joel Savage, born on December twenty-fifth, nineteen sixty-nine, is a former professional ice hockey player from Canada. He made his mark in the sport by being drafted in the first round, thirteenth overall, by the Buffalo Sabres during the nineteen eighty-eight NHL Entry Draft.
During the nineteen ninety-one season, Savage had the opportunity to showcase his skills in the NHL, playing three games with the Sabres. Although his time in the league was brief, it highlighted his journey from junior hockey to the professional arena.
Before entering the NHL, Savage honed his talents with the Victoria Cougars in the Western Hockey League, where he accumulated an impressive one hundred forty-three points over the course of one hundred ninety-seven games. This performance laid the foundation for his professional career and demonstrated his potential as a skilled player.
